Bookmark cubic meter/hour to cubic foot/minute Conversion Calculator - you ...To convert Nm3/hr to Sm3/hr it's a ratio of the absolute temperatures - (The difference between 0 and 15.5 deg C) 10 Nm3/hr *(15.6+273)/ (0+273) = 10.57 Sm3/hr Where -273 is absolute zero on the temperature scale. To convert either of the above to Am3/hr or m3/hr (as normally written) you need to convert both the temperature and pressure ratios

If you need to convert cubic meters/hour to other units, please try our universal Flow Unit …1 Cubic meter per hour (m3/h) is equal to 0.58857777022 cubic feet per minute (cfm). To convert cubic meters per hour to cubic feet per minute, multiply the cubic meters per hour value by 0.58857777022 or divide by 1.69901082.
